Output 59cac3bfea66f5e7164ff8b32c05554648fb08337efe1a3f2c3230bee060428f:6

value
11779628
script pubkey
OP_0 OP_PUSHBYTES_20 0f5abe05c8e5ee44b43045969a4d9aaa9f46e3a8
address
bc1qpadtupwguhhyfdpsgktf5nv64205dcag4k9qrj
transaction
59cac3bfea66f5e7164ff8b32c05554648fb08337efe1a3f2c3230bee060428f
spent
true